Recombinant Murine TARC (CCL17) 0 AvisSubmit a Review Détails du Produit Catalog Number: 250-43 Description: TARC, a CC chemokine, is predominantly produced by dendritic cells in the thymus, and signals through the CCR4 receptor. TARC is chemotactic towards T cells. Recombinant Murine TARC (CCL17) is an 7.9 kDa protein containing 70 amino acid residues, including the four conserved cysteine residues present in CC chemokines. Source: E.coli Synonyms: Thymus and Activation Regulated Chemokine, CCL17, ABCD-2 AA Sequence: ARATNVGREC CLDYFKGAIP IRKLVSWYKT SVECSRDAIV FLTVQGKLIC ADPKDKHVKK AIRLVKNPRP Purity: ≥ 98% by SDS-PAGE gel and HPLC analyses. Biological Activity: Determined by its ability to chemoattract murine BW5147.3 thymic lymphoma cells. The ED50 for this effect is 10-40 ng/ml.
